Coldwell Banker Rizzo Mattson Realtors in Augusta was named the top Coldwell Banker office in the state for the third year in a row by the national real estate franchise, according to a release from the Augusta company.

The owner of Coldwell Banker Rizzo Mattson Realtors, Brian Rizzo, said he is honored to be recognized for his agency’s success.

“We have a fantastic team of experienced agents who have earned the trust and repeat business of their clients. We try to focus on creating positive transactions through a commitment to service,” Rizzo said in the release.

He said the economy is showing signs of strengthening and he’s optimistic about the real estate market for this year.

“We are experiencing early buyer demand and a noticeable reduction of inventory as we head towards the spring market. All positive signs for a favorable 2014 real estate market,” Rizzo said.

Several individual agents at the Capitol Street agency were recognized by the national real estate franchise, including Jean Kirkpatrick, who was named to the Coldwell Banker International President’s Elite, a designation for the top 2 percent of all sales associates in the Coldwell Banker system; and Kevin Judkins, who was recognized as being among the top 5 percent of Coldwell Banker sales associates.
